As it stands now FRIENDLY FIRE does a small amount of damage to the teammate who was hit, but it also cancels your attack if you are hit by a friendly, which is not a deterrent for a selfish player on your team who is either trying to steal the kill or is just inexperienced (80% of the players are selfish and oblivious to team play).
I propose a friendly fire strike does damage to the CULPRIT because this would make them think twice about wildly swinging into a teammate's back. The times I've been most frustrated with this game are with connectivity and with my teammates -- very rarely because of an enemy player.
Here is a common occurrence...
I fight an enemy player 1v1 and I have him to about 15 - 20 damage left. I get a GB and... Boom! I'm hit in the back by one of my teammate's attacks. This now cancels what would have been an execution and instead turns it into an opportunity for the enemy to either block (and most likely get revenge) or worse, my teammate follows with another attack and just straight steals the kill from me..
Now not only did he take my kill, but he now also thinks that what he did was an intelligent idea and will continue to do it FOREVER.
This specific mechanic in the gameplay needs to be changed so that friendly fire is an electric fence/shock collar for selfish and quite frankly poor players.
